技术文摘
Ubuntu 命令行终端中管理 KVM 虚拟机教程
Ubuntu 命令行终端中管理 KVM 虚拟机教程
在 Ubuntu 系统中,利用命令行终端来管理 KVM 虚拟机是一项强大而高效的技能。本文将为您详细介绍如何在 Ubuntu 命令行终端中进行 KVM 虚拟机的管理。
确保您的 Ubuntu 系统已经安装了 KVM 相关的软件包。您可以通过以下命令检查:sudo apt-get install qemu-kvm libvirt-bin virt-manager virt-viewer 。如果尚未安装,系统会自动为您进行安装。
创建虚拟机之前,需要准备好安装镜像文件。使用以下命令创建新的虚拟机:virt-install --name=YourVMName --ram=2048 --vcpus=2 --disk path=/var/lib/libvirt/images/YourVM.img,size=20 --cdrom /path/to/your/iso/file --network network=default --os-type=linux --os-variant=rhel7 。在此命令中,您需要根据实际情况修改虚拟机名称、内存大小、CPU 核心数、磁盘路径和大小、ISO 镜像文件路径等参数。
创建完成后,您可以通过 virsh list --all 命令查看虚拟机的状态。如果虚拟机处于关机状态,可使用 virsh start YourVMName 命令启动虚拟机。
要关闭虚拟机,有两种方式。一种是温和的关机,使用 virsh shutdown YourVMName 命令;另一种是强制关机,使用 virsh destroy YourVMName 命令,但强制关机可能会导致数据丢失,建议在必要时使用。
对于虚拟机的配置修改,例如调整内存大小、CPU 核心数等,可以通过 virsh edit YourVMName 命令进行。但请注意,修改配置时要谨慎操作,以免导致虚拟机无法正常运行。
还可以通过 virsh console YourVMName 命令连接到虚拟机的控制台,进行一些特殊的操作和故障排查。
在 Ubuntu 命令行终端中管理 KVM 虚拟机,需要熟悉相关的命令和参数,同时要对虚拟机的运行原理有一定的了解。不断地实践和尝试,您将能够熟练地运用命令行终端来高效地管理 KVM 虚拟机,满足您的各种需求。
通过以上介绍,相信您已经对在 Ubuntu 命令行终端中管理 KVM 虚拟机有了初步的认识和了解。祝您在虚拟机管理的过程中一切顺利!
TAGS: 虚拟机教程 KVM 虚拟机 Ubuntu 命令行 终端管理
- Docker 中安装 Geoserver 的步骤方法
- Zabbix 配置 WEB 监控的详细图文指引
- Zabbix 中 PING 监控的配置方法
- vscode 连接 openEuler 服务器的方法
- Docker 部署 Prometheus 实现案例
- Docker 查看日志命令的实现流程
- nginx 中上传文件大小的设置方法
- 多级缓存的应用(nginx 本地缓存、JVM 进程缓存、redis 缓存)
- DockerUI:Docker 可视化管理工具的运用
- 手动构建 Docker JDK 镜像的实现案例
- Docker 中无法使用 Vim 的问题与解决办法
- Docker 容器启用 IPv6 地址的流程与方法
- Docker 镜像拉取失败的问题剖析与解决办法
- Linux 切换用户时环境变量消失的问题与解决办法
- Ubuntu Server 22.04 安装 Docker 详细步骤记录